Fantastic holiday - great walking, amazing views and fab food what's not to like!
5 - Excellent
  • Anonymous
My husband and l had a great time on this trip. The area is gorgeous and the varied walks allow you to really get a feel for the place. We particularly enjoyed the views on the Aiguillette des Houches and Auguillette du Brevent walk and the walk through the alpine meadows in Italy. Walking in this region even in peak season August is not as busy as we feared on the trails which was a nice surprise. Can be like sheep all following the masses up the paths in the Breacons Beacons for example but it just wasn't like that. Yes a few people up the summits and the no 2 transfer bus was uncomfortably packed at times but otherwise good. There is so much to do on the free day if you want. Sarah and Rich are really lovely at the Chalet Chamonix - prepare to eat restaurant quality 3 course meals and very yummy afternoon tea homemade cakes. The chalet sits within easy reach of Chamonix town which is nice to visit at the end of the day's walk. Chamonix is very vibrant and bustling with lots of shops and a good bakery or two. Our group was a really nice bunch of people and made for lovely walking and scrabble fests in the evening!
